On average across the year,
yes, South Africa is hotter than
Smyrna, Georgia
.
South Africa has an average temperature of 19°C/66°F and Smyrna, Georgia has an average temperature of 17°C/63°F.
South Africa's hottest month is January, with an average maximum temperature of 30°C/86°F, which is not hotter than Smyrna, Georgia's hottest month (July, with an average maximum temperature of 32°C/90°F).
On average across the year, no, South Africa is not colder than Smyrna, Georgia . South Africa has an average minimum temperature of 12°C/54°F and Smyrna, Georgia has an average minimum temperature of 11°C/52°F.
On average across the year,
no, South Africa has less rain than
Smyrna, Georgia. South Africa has an average annual rainfall of 446mm and Smyrna, Georgia has an average annual rainfall of 1445mm.
South Africa's wettest month is December, with an average monthly rainfall of 70mm, which is drier than Smyrna, Georgia's wettest month (also December, with an average monthly rainfall of 151mm).
